Transaction 3fbf2e23dc620cbdd231693652ea2e22c3e54f50d383a5b34d652ed366f20521

1 Input
2 Outputs
  • 3fbf2e23dc620cbdd231693652ea2e22c3e54f50d383a5b34d652ed366f20521:0
  • value  16882051217
    address  1PKkm2RdhackoyVFmZiCUDKKwChxCzbe93
  • 3fbf2e23dc620cbdd231693652ea2e22c3e54f50d383a5b34d652ed366f20521:1
  • value  3721634
    address  3GZRKvBLpiC74oGbJq4jhDH38KMVSRhjLb